The Request That Came From Inside the House: Revolut, SPF, and the Collapse of Institutional Trust

CryptoNode โ€ข โ€ข Law

Beneath the surface of every institutional security posture sits a single, quietly dangerous assumption: that a message arriving from a verified domain, carrying valid authentication credentials, must therefore come from a trusted hand. Revolut โ€” the London-based fintech that has spent a decade positioning itself as the friendly threshold between retail banking and crypto โ€” learned the cost of that assumption this month. The company confirmed that an unauthorized mailbox, one living inside the genuine infrastructure of a real government agency, sent a request for customer data. The request passed SPF, DKIM, and DMARC. The authentication chain held. Revolut complied. Passports, selfies, home addresses, IBANs, and full transaction histories left the building.

No password was stolen. No PIN was lifted. No private key left the vault. That detail โ€” which the company has been careful to foreground โ€” is precisely the one that should make you uneasy. We are hunting for truth in a mirror maze of hype.

To understand what actually broke, you have to understand what Revolut is. It is not a protocol. It has no token, no governance forum, no on-chain treasury to scrutinize. It is a centralized financial institution with a crypto desk bolted to its side โ€” a KYC gateway that happens to let you buy Bitcoin. That architecture means every regulatory obligation it satisfies becomes, by definition, a concentrated honeypot. Anti-money-laundering rules compel it to collect passports, proof of address, selfies, bank account numbers, and the complete record of a customer's trading activity. When those records are cross-referenced against a public blockchain, the result is not a dataset. It is a biography.

Revolut is the latest entry in that ledger. It is not a rogue actor; it is a compliant one. That is what makes the failure instructive.

It is tempting to call this a hack. It is not. Nothing in the cryptographic stack was broken; no algorithm failed, no key was derived, no chain was reorganized. The attack surface was a workflow โ€” the institutional habit of treating a credentialed email from a government domain as a verified instruction. That is a micro-innovation rather than a paradigm shift, and micro-innovations are the most dangerous kind, because they exploit assumptions that everyone has already agreed to stop questioning.

The forged instruction carried valid authentication credentials and originated from an unauthorized mailbox inside a real agency's domain. SPF, DKIM, and DMARC โ€” the three pillars of email authentication that most security teams treat as a bright line between legitimate and malicious โ€” all passed. The trust chain did not fail because it was weak; it failed because it was asked to certify an identity it was never built to verify. Email authentication proves that a domain sent a message. It does not prove that the human holding that domain is authorized to request a passport. That distinction is where the entire event lives.

The leaked material is where the second-order damage begins. Identity documents, live selfies, residential addresses, IBANs, transaction histories โ€” individually, each field is an annoyance; combined, they are an operational dossier. Enough to open fraudulent credit lines. Enough to satisfy knowledge-based authentication at secondary institutions. Enough to compose phishing messages that quote genuine account details and therefore bypass the reader's instinct for fraud.

The company has been quick to note what did not leak: no passwords, no card PINs, no private keys, and no customer funds reported stolen. That reassurance is real, and it should be weighed honestly. But it is also a category error, and it deserves to be named as one. The asset at risk was never the money. The asset at risk was the identity โ€” and identity is not insured, not reversible, and not recoverable by a support ticket. A stolen key can be rotated. A stolen passport number follows its owner for a decade.

Then there is the on-chain dimension, which the disclosure has handled with conspicuous silence. Bitcoin transaction histories are public by design; that is the point of a transparent ledger. But pseudonymity is a much thinner shield than the industry likes to admit. Once a verified identity, a home address, and a transaction history sit in the same stolen file, the barrier between a wallet address and a human being collapses. The blockchain did not leak. It simply became targetable. For an attacker weighing a physical threat or a precision extortion attempt, that combination is not a nuisance โ€” it is a map.

The reaction from inside the industry has been sharper than the disclosure itself. Aave's Marc Zeller publicly claimed that Revolut had pressured customers for large volumes of additional data shortly before the breach โ€” and argued that, in the end, the company did the attackers' work for them. Whether or not that charge survives scrutiny, the underlying criticism is structural: institutions that treat data collection as a compliance ritual, endlessly demanding more while protecting less, are not merely negligent โ€” they are pre-positioning their own customers for exactly this outcome.

The on-chain investigator ZachXBT assessed the scope as limited and suggested the targeting may have been aimed at high-net-worth clients. If correct, that detail quietly changes the profile of the attacker. A spray-and-pray phishing campaign does not usually know which mailbox to compromise, or which customer subset to request. A limited, curated, high-value leak implies premeditation and inside knowledge โ€” not opportunism. Kraken's Jesse Karpelรจs made the practical consequence explicit: identifying which institution was compromised would let other banks and exchanges check whether they received identical requests. That is the logic of a shared threat โ€” and Revolut has so far declined to provide the name.

Which brings us to the opacity, and to the ledger. Revolut has not confirmed which government agency was impersonated. It has not disclosed how many customers were affected. It has not said whether it has changed how it verifies government information requests. It has contacted regulators, blocked the address, and begun notifying customers โ€” all correct steps, and all partial. In a system where trust is the only asset that cannot be engineered, withholding the operational details of a breach is not caution; it is a second, quieter withdrawal from the same account.

Here is the contrarian read, and it cuts against the comfortable narrative forming on both sides. The prevailing story is that Revolut failed. A stricter reading is that Revolut was failed by a shared model that every regulated institution is compelled to adopt. Data-minimization principles exist precisely because centralized collection manufactures centralized risk; yet compliance regimes worldwide keep mandating ever-deeper collection while offering no compensating architecture. The paradox is airtight: the same KYC apparatus designed to protect the financial system is the apparatus that turns a single forged email into a mass identity event. You cannot solve that with better spam filters. You solve it by not holding what you cannot defend.

The reflexive conclusion โ€” "not your keys, not your coins" โ€” is partly right and dangerously incomplete. Self-custody removes the institutional honeypot, and that matters enormously. But it does nothing about an on-chain footprint that is public by construction, or about a passport scan now sitting in a foreign database. The realistic posture is not exit; it is compartmentalization โ€” separating identity from assets, holding only what a given institution actually needs, and assuming that any data you hand over is already, in some sense, leaked.

The ledger remembers what the heart forgets.

So watch the disclosure, not the apology. The arc of this story will be written by three unanswerable questions: how many customers were exposed, which agency's infrastructure was abused, and whether any other bank or exchange received the same forged request. If the answer to the third is yes, then this was never a Revolut incident at all โ€” it was the first visible symptom of a systemic trust failure that the entire regulated crypto perimeter has quietly been carrying for years. The question is no longer whether the request was real. It is which institution will admit, next, that it believed it too.
